Description

Masala Dosa is a renowned South Indian delicacy combining crispy rice-lentil crepes with a spiced potato filling. Its thin, golden surface offers a delightful crunch, while the savory filling provides warmth and spice. Celebrated for its unique fermentation, it bridges cultural boundaries, bringing global palates an exquisite taste of India.

Preparation steps:

1. Soak 1 cup of rice and 1/3 cup of urad dal separately for 4-6 hours.
2. Grind them separately, then mix, adding salt and water to form a smooth batter. Ferment overnight.
3. Boil 2 medium potatoes, then mash.
4. In a pan, heat 2 tablespoons of oil. Add 1 teaspoon mustard seeds, 1 chopped onion, and saute.
5. Add 1 teaspoon turmeric, mashed potatoes, and salt. Cook until blended.
6. Heat a non-stick pan, pour a ladle of batter, and spread thinly.
7. Drizzle oil, cook until crisp and golden.
8. Place potato filling inside, fold, and serve hot.
